Title: ●Energy Conservation Program: Energy Conservation Standards for General Service Lamps  
Abstract:

The Energy Policy and Conservation Act, as amended (EPCA), directs the U.S. Department of Energy (DO) to initiate two rulemaking cycles for general service lamps (GSLs) that, among other requirements, determine whether standards in effect for GSLs should be amended. EPCA also requires DOE to periodically determine whether more-stringent standards would be technologically feasible and economically justified, and would result in significant energy savings.  DOE is examining whether to amend standards for GSLs pursuant to its statutory authority in EPCA.
